Prince Alfred Ernest Albert, Duke of Edinburgh, in enamel on gold, by John Simpson, signed & dated 1846. Prince Alfred Ernest Albert (1844-1900), the second
son of Queen Victoria and Prince Albert, was created Duke of Edinburgh, Earl
of Kent and Earl of Ulster. He entered the Royal Navy at the age of sixteen,
rising to the rank of Admiral of the Fleet. Known as "Affie" to his
family because of his affable ways, the much loved Duke married Grand Duchess
Maria Alexandrovna, the only daughter of Czar Alexander II. Their six children
included a future Queen of Romania and an Infanta of Spain. Upon the death
of his uncle, Ernst II in 1893, the Duke became ruler of the duchy of Saxe-Coburg
